Average-consensus filter problem of assigned constant inputs is investigated for the first-order multi-agent systems with heterogeneous disturbances, and a proportional-integral consensus filter algorithm accompanied with disturbances' observers is designed. By using matrix theory and frequency-domain analysis, sufficient and necessary convergence conditions are obtained for our proposed algorithm without and with identical communication delay, respectively. Numerical simulations illustrate the correctness of theoretical results.
